all: $(MANUALS)
-# todo: separate build dir still doesn't work
-html/index.html: $(top_srcdir)/src/*.cpp $(top_srcdir)/src/*.hxx $(top_srcdir)/codegen/*.hxx $(top_srcdir)/codegen/*.cpp $(srcdir)/index.doc
- if [ "$srcdir" = "$builddir" ]; then $(DOXYGEN); else echo "FIXME: doxygen documentation cannot be built using a seperate build directory"; fi
+html/index.html: $(top_srcdir)/src/*.cpp $(top_srcdir)/src/*.hxx $(top_srcdir)/codegen/*.hxx $(top_srcdir)/codegen/*.cpp $(srcdir)/index.doc Doxyfile
+ $(DOXYGEN)
-EXTRA_DIST = index.doc header.html
+EXTRA_DIST = index.doc header.html Doxyfile.in